Here is a recipe of simple doughnuts. The ingredients necessary are 500 grams of flour, 120 grams of butter, 40 grams yeast, and 1 spoon of sugar, 1 teaspoon of rum, lemon peel, a little salt, 250 ml of milk, and two yolks.

First, you have to mix the yeast and the sugar and rub them until they get a liquid appearance, then you have to add the butter, the yolks one by one, the rum, the lemon peel, the warm milk and then the flour. Then you must let the composition grow for about 20 minutes. After that you have to stretch 2 cm thick dough, you can use a glass to detach parts of it, then let them grow again for 20 minutes.

Another easy Romanian recipe that is good for the taste buds is the potato broth. The ingredients you require are 600 grams of potatoes, 100 grams of onions, 100 grams of carrots, 50 grams of parsley, a liter of borsch, a bunch of green parsley and another of lovage along with a little salt.

First, you cut the potatoes in square shapes and set it aside. Next, fry the verdure with sliced onions in oil. Then add some water and a little bit of salt and the potatoes. Let it boil for some time. Boil the borsch in another pot and add the mixture with the potatoes when they become tender. Add more salt if required and dress it with verdure to serve.

If you would like to cook a meat preparation, meat balls could be what you are looking for. It is a typical Romanian dish that takes very little of your effort and time. You are going to need 500 grams of minced meat, 50 grams of bread, 50 grams of onions, 3 to 4 garlic cloves, an egg, oil, pepper, salt, and parsley or dill to cook this delicious preparation.

First you dip the bread in water and press the excess water out. Keep it aside. Fry the onions in about 2 teaspoon of oil.

Add together the minced meat, minced parsley or dill, one egg, a bit of pepper, salt, and garlic and mix them well. Pour some flour or breadcrumbs on a plate and keep it aside. Next, make small ball shapes using the meat mixture and roll them over the flour or crust. Now preheat a pan for a few minutes at a medium temperature, pour in oil half a centimeter deep and fry the meatballs quickly. Fry them on one side, turn them over and fry some more and then take them off the pan to put in new ones. To keep them warm and soft, place them in a bowl over a pot of hot water and cover with a lid.

You can serve them warm, with vegetables or salad, with beans salad, cabbage, spinach or nettles, and if you serve them cold you can add to them green pepper, tomatoes, radish, or mustard. Easy Romanian recipes are useful and delicious and you can try them whenever you want to save time.
